On episode ONE HUNDRED AND SEVEN of Let the Bird Fly! Mike welcomes back frequent guest Rev. Brian Doebler. Those who have heard Rev. Doebler on previous episodes might remember that he is currently working on a PhD in Missiology at Concordia Theological Seminary in Fort Wayne, Indiana. As this is a topic the Rev. Doebler has thought about more than most, Mike asked him if he’d be willing to do a few episodes on different aspects of Missiology. This episode focuses on Missiology in the Old Testament.
